SLOW COOKER PINEAPPLE-BBQ MEATBALLS

This recipe is a snap to put together with frozen meatballs, pre-made BBQ sauce, and a can of pineapple chunks. Everyone always loves it served as an appetizer at parties and pitch-ins, or my family likes it served over rice for a dinner meal.

Provided by Tammy Lynn

Time 2h5m

Yield 10

Number Of Ingredients 6



Slow Cooker Pineapple-BBQ Meatballs image

Steps:

  • Combine frozen meatballs, barbeque sauce, pineapple chunks and juice, onion, bell pepper, and garlic powder in a slow cooker. Mix all ingredients together until the meatballs are well covered with sauce using a large spoon. Put the lid on the slow cooker.
  • Cook on Low for 4 to 6 hours, or High for 2 to 3 hours. Stir well before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 311.5 calories, Carbohydrate 34.7 g, Cholesterol 75.4 mg, Fat 11.9 g, Fiber 1.5 g, Protein 15.7 g, SaturatedFat 4.2 g, Sodium 677.3 mg, Sugar 22.1 g

2 (16 ounce) packages frozen meatballs
1 (18 ounce) bottle barbeque sauce
1 (20 ounce) can pineapple chunks with juice
1 medium onion, diced
1 bell peppers, diced
1 teaspoon garlic powder

JERK CHICKEN MEATBALLS WITH BARBECUE-PINEAPPLE GLAZE

This recipe takes the deep flavor of jerk chicken and turns it into easy meatballs. The jerk seasoning paste does double duty here, adding both spices and moisture, so don't reach for dry jerk seasoning. Whether served alone as an appetizer, over rice, or even tucked in a sandwich, these meatballs are perfectly salty, sweet and spicy.

Provided by Millie Peartree

Categories     meatballs, poultry, appetizer, main course

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 20



Jerk Chicken Meatballs With Barbecue-Pineapple Glaze image

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 375 degrees. Line a sheet pan with aluminum foil and very lightly coat it with oil.
  • Prepare the meatballs: In a medium bowl, combine the chicken, onion, egg, bread crumbs, jerk seasoning paste, parsley, garlic powder, salt and pepper. Mix thoroughly to combine, being careful not to overwork the meat. Using lightly wet hands, form the mixture into 12 meatballs, each a bit larger than a golf ball, and space them out on the prepared pan. Bake until golden brown, about 15 minutes. (Alternatively, you can fry them in a nonstick pan coated in oil over medium heat for about 4 to 5 minutes per side.)
  • While the meatballs cook, prepare the glaze: Whisk the pineapple juice, brown sugar, ketchup, Worcestershire sauce, garlic, onion powder, red-pepper flakes and salt together in a medium pot over medium-high heat.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to medium-low. Simmer until it reduces enough to coat the back of a spoon, about 10 to 15 minutes.
  • In a small bowl, mix together the cornstarch with 1 tablespoon water. Slowly whisk into the sauce, increase the heat to medium and stir until you reach the desired consistency. (Sauce should look like a thicker gravy.) Taste and adjust seasoning as needed.
  • Add the meatballs to the sauce and stir until coated. Cook over medium-low heat for 2 minutes, until the meatballs are evenly glazed and deepen slightly in color. Serve hot on their own or over rice.

Neutral oil
1 pound ground chicken or turkey
1 small yellow or red onion, finely diced
1 egg, beaten
1/4 cup bread crumbs
2 tablespoons Jamaican jerk seasoning paste, such as Grace or Walkerswood
1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ley or cilantro leaves
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
1 cup pineapple juice
1/2 packed cup light or dark brown sugar
1/4 cup ketchup
2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
1 small garlic clove, minced
1/2 teaspoon onion powder
Pinch of red-pepper flakes
Pinch of kosher salt, plus more to taste
1 tablespoon cornstarch
White rice, for serving

PINEAPPLE MEATBALLS

This is a family favourite; my teenage son eats at least 2 servings himself. Cooking time includes the browning of the meatballs, although you can brown them in the oven on a cookie sheet and make the sauce at the same time, saving yourself a little time.

Provided by Lennie

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time 1h25m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14



Pineapple Meatballs image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350F degrees.
  • First, make the meatballs: combine all meatball ingredients (there's 7, beef to garlic powder) in a bowl and mix well; shape into 1-inch balls.
  • Brown them in a nonstick frying pan (I do it in 3 batches) until browned all over; drain on paper towel then place in a large ungreased casserole dish.
  • To make sauce, combine brown sugar and cornstarch in a large saucepan, then whisk in the 1-3/4 cup pineapple juice/water combination until mixture is smooth.
  • Add vinegar, soy sauce and worcestershire sauce; stir.
  • Simmer, uncovered, on medium-low heat for about 8 minutes, or until thickened.
  • Pour sauce over meatballs and add pineapple tidbits; stir gently to combine until meatballs are coated with sauce.
  • Bake in preheated oven for 30 minutes.
  • If you want a lot, this recipe doubles well.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 559.5, Fat 17.4, SaturatedFat 6.8, Cholesterol 160.3, Sodium 869.4, Carbohydrate 65.3, Fiber 1.6, Sugar 50.4, Protein 34.7

2 lbs lean ground beef
2 large eggs
1/2 cup fine dry breadcrumb
1 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 1/2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
1 cup packed brown sugar
3 tablespoons cornstarch
1 3/4 cups reserved pineapple juice, plus water if necessary to measure (it will be)
1/4 cup white vinegar
1 1/2 tablespoons soy sauce
1 1/2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
1 (14 ounce) can pineapple tidbits, juice drained and reserved (see above)
